Cardinals vs Reds Preview

The St. Louis Cardinals head to Cincinnati to play the Reds on Sunday. The Cardinals have a record of 68-69 and are currently ranked fourth in their division. They have won their last three games and are 5-5 in their last ten. Andre Pallante will start on the mound for the Cardinals. He has an ERA of 5.44 and a WHIP of 1.42 this season.

The Cincinnati Reds will host the Cardinals with a record of 68-68. They are third in the division but have lost their last five games. Their recent form shows a 2-8 record over the last ten games. Brady Singer will be the starting pitcher for the Reds. He has an ERA of 4.06 and a WHIP of 1.27. The game will be played at the Great American Ball Park and is expected to have clear skies with a light breeze.

Cincinnati Reds: Key Players and Performance

Elly De La Cruz is leading the Cincinnati Reds in several categories. He has a batting average of .273 and has played in 136 games. He has hit 19 home runs and scored 93 runs, both ranking first on the team. Spencer Steer is another important player for the Reds. He has played 126 games with a batting average of .235. Steer has hit 17 home runs and scored 55 runs, placing him second on the team in both categories. Brady Singer is the starting pitcher for the Reds in this game. His ERA is 4.06, and his WHIP is 1.27. Singer has a record of 11 wins and 9 losses this season.

St. Louis Cardinals: Players and Pitching Overview

Willson Contreras leads the Cardinals with 20 home runs. He also has 74 RBIs, both ranking first on the team. His batting average is .253 over 126 games. Alec Burleson is another key player for the Cardinals. He has a batting average of .286 in 122 games. Burleson has hit 16 home runs and scored 47 runs. On the mound, Andre Pallante is the starting pitcher for the Cardinals. His ERA is 5.44, and his WHIP is 1.42. Pallante’s record stands at 6 wins and 12 losses this season.
